Vem är "Maja Lundgren" i Maja Lundgrens Myggor och tigrar? : Fakta och fiktion som ontologi, framställningssätt eller retorisk kommunikationsakt
Maja Lundgren’s outspoken description in Myggor och tigrar (2007) of the male dominated cultural life of Sweden raised an animated debate in media. Well known authors and journalists felt themselves scandalized and accused Lundgren of being paranoid. Others claimed that the narrator and character »Maja Lundgren« was not to be confused with Maja Lundgren the author, because the book was fictional and not factual. In this article I discuss Myggor och tigrar out from different fiction theories and conclude that it seems most rewarding to approach the problem of fictionality as a question of rhetorical communication rather than ontology or stylistic devices. I also maintain that Lundgren’s book would implode if read as fiction, since the rhetorical strategy implies the identity of the author and the character.</p

ENGLISH :
The Maja Selatan Village Government through the Village Deliberation established an economic institution, namely the Maja Selatan Village Owned Enterprise and was legally ratified in 2018 with the issuance of Maja Selatan Village Regulation Number 141/03/2018 Year 2018 concerning Maja Selatan Village Owned Enterprises, with the aim of increasing Village Original Income (PADes) and also empower the Maja Selatan community.
This study aims to determine the extent of the implementation of Maja Selatan Village Regulation Number 141/03/2018 Year 2018 concerning Maja Selatan Village-Owned Enterprises in Maja Selatan Village, Maja District, Majalengka Regency.
The author uses the theory of Policy Implementation according to Edward III in which there are four dimensions that can determine the success of implementing a policy, namely communication, resources, disposition, and bureaucratic structure. These four dimensions are also used as indicators to measure the extent to which the implementation of Maja Selatan Village Regulation Number 141/03/2018 Year 2018 concerning Business Entities Owned by Maja Selatan Village in Maja Selatan Village, Maja District, Majalengka Regency.
The research method used is a qualitative method with a descriptive approach. The type of data used is the type of qualitative data with primary and secondary data sources. Data collection techniques through direct observation, interviews and documentation. The data analysis technique used according to Miles and Huberman consists of three stages, namely, 1) data reduction, 2) data presentation, and 3) drawing conclusions and verification.
The results of the study revealed that Maja Village Regulation Number 141/03/2018 2018 concerning Business Entities Owned by Maja Selatan Village in Maja Selatan Village, Maja District, Majalengka Regency had not run optimally as stipulated in the regulation. This is because in the implementation and running of the Village-Owned Enterprise program there are obstacles to the lack of community participation, lack of capital for the sustainability of Village-Owned Enterprises, the quality of the operational staff of Village-Owned Enterprises which is still not good in managing Village-Owned Enterprises
Maja Haderlap and the Peripheries of Memory
In December, acclaimed author Maja Haderlap came to the Austrian Cultural Forum here in London to talk about her work in the context of a conference series on recent Austrian literature. Iga Nowicz went along and here she reflects on memory, history and the challenge of capturing experience in text as felt in Haderlap’s Slovenian-speaking community and elsewhere after the Second World War

Potrebno je spremljanje novosti o širitvi debelosti med ženskami in več novih raziskav na področju intervencij medicinskih sester, ki bodo pripomogle k zmanjšanju težave, kot je debelost.Introduction: Obesity is an epidemic of today`s time, which is becoming increasingly widespread among women. It develops as a result of a number of factors, which have a profound effect in psychological, physical and economic fields. Obesity in nursing needs to be addressed as it is a key problem affecting women`s health. Purpose: We want to determine the prevalence of obesity among women in Europe and Slovenia, the factors that influence its development and its consequences. We also want to find out how nursing professionals can be involved in dealing with the problem. Methods: In the paper, we used the descriptive research method, with an overview of scientific and academic literature. We focused on publications published between the year 2010 and October 2020 and written in English and Slovenian. The literature was searched in the following databases: Medline/ PubMed, CINAHL, ScienceDirect, COBIB.SI and Google Scholar, using the following keywords: obesity AND women AND nursing, obesity around the world AND women, obesity AND the role of a nurse, obesity in Europe AND women, obesity among women in Europe, obesity among women in Slovenia. The analysis comprised 24 articles. The articles were evaluated on a four-point scale according to the strength of the evidence. Results: Obesity is a health problem in Europe as well as in our country. The findings show an increase in overweight and obesity among European women, which has fluctuated over the years and is still increasing drastically. It is escalating in women of all ages, and it is most prevalent in the female population aged above 50 years. The most common factors influencing the development of obesity include daily stress, lack of time, improper diet, reduced physical activity, and the level of education. Obesity has a number of consequences for women`s health, including type 2 diabetes, musculoskeletal diseases, cardiovascular diseases, and socioeconomic consequences. Moreover, it has an impact on mortality. Nurses play an important role in managing obesity among women, offering support and providing motivation. Discussion and conclusion: Obesity can cause frightening complications for women`s health. It is still not adequately discussed, but it is presenting a challenge to healthcare staff. Nurses are key to health education, prevention and raising women`s awareness regarding the impact of obesity on their health. New developments about the spread of obesity among women must be monitored and more new research into nursing interventions is required to help reduce such a problem as obesity

Međutim, bez obzira na pojedine čimbenike, na poduzetnički proces u obje države značajno utječu svi čimbenici iz poduzetničkog okruženja te se svako poduzeće na svoj način prilagođava kako bi uspješno poslovalo.In every entrepreneur’s venture there are various obstacles such as financing, insufficient planning, mismanagement and lack of information and knowledge. Every part of this process, from establishing the company, to its survival and day to day business, contains new problems that need to be addressed very quickly and there are numerous circumstances that the company has to be prepared for. One of the most important elements in establishing a successful company is the entrepreneurial environment. This paper will examine the differences in motivation to start and sustain a successful entrepreneurial venture between the Republic of Croatia and United Kingdom by analyzing different factors that influence the development of a new business venture, such as time, costs, government support, financing methods, education, market regulations, etc. In addition, each environment affecting the establishment and survival of a business venture, including economic, legal, political, social, technological, etc. will be described and examined, and an interview will be conducted with an English and a Croatian entrepreneur in order to explore the differences between their experiences in entrepreneurial venture. The research conducted through interviews with the Croatian and English entrepreneurs leads to the conclusion that a major obstacle in entrepreneurial activities in Croatia are the laws that are passed too quickly and with short-term action, which disrupts the successful operation of the company. In the United Kingdom, the biggest problem is the lack of support for expansion of companies, increasing the number of its workers and internationalizing companies in certain industries. However, regardless of individual factors, the entrepreneurial process in both countries is significantly influenced by all the factors of the entrepreneurial environment, and each company adapts in its own way to operate successfully
